Swimcart Beach, nestled in Tasmania's Bay of Fires Conservation Area, offers a pristine coastal experience with its 1.5 km stretch of white sand and clear blue waters. The beach is divided into north and south sections by Swimcart Lagoon, often separated from the sea. It's a favored spot for camping, swimming, snorkeling, and surf fishing. The adjacent campground accommodates tents, caravans, and campervans, providing basic facilities like hybrid and pit toilets. Camping is free, with a maximum stay of four weeks. Access is via Gardens Road, approximately 4 km from the Binalong Bay Road intersection.
